Understanding Space Heaters for Large Rooms

Choosing the right space heater for large areas can significantly impact comfort and energy consumption. There are various types of space heaters suitable for larger rooms, each offering distinct advantages depending on the room size and insulation. Electric space heaters are popular for their straightforward operation and low maintenance, while propane heaters are often praised for their strong heat output, making them excellent choices for poorly insulated spaces. Additionally, oil-filled radiators are valued for their silent operation and long-lasting warmth.

When selecting a space heater, considering the room’s size and insulation is crucial. Larger spaces or rooms with poor insulation might require heaters with higher wattage to achieve the desired temperature efficiently. Conversely, a well-insulated room can benefit from a heater that uses less energy while still maintaining warmth.

Key Features to Consider

When selecting a space heater for large spaces, several key features must be evaluated to ensure both effectiveness and safety.

Energy efficiency is paramount, as efficient heaters consume less electricity while providing adequate warmth. Look for models with high energy efficiency ratings to reduce electricity costs in expansive areas. Efficiency also contributes to environmental sustainability, a growing concern for many consumers.

Safety is another crucial consideration. Features like overheat protection and tip-over switches significantly enhance user safety. These safety measures automatically shut off the device if it overheats or falls, reducing the risk of accidents, especially in busy environments.

Finally, consider the heating capacity relative to the room size. The heater should adequately cover the intended space to maintain consistent warmth. Check the wattage and BTUs (British Thermal Units) when assessing a heater’s capacity. A higher wattage often correlates with greater heating ability, crucial for poorly insulated rooms. Prioritising these features ensures a safe, efficient warmth solution tailored to large spaces.

Assessing Propane Heater Models

Propane heaters stand out for their robust heat output. They excel in poorly insulated and large rooms, providing substantial heat relatively quickly. Many users highlight their effectiveness in rapidly changing the temperature of a space. A common concern, however, is their fuel dependency, which can lead to higher operational costs and the necessity for regular refills. Additionally, safety considerations regarding the ventilation of these heaters are frequently mentioned, as sufficient airflow is crucial to safe operation.

Evaluating Oil-Filled Radiators

Oil-filled radiators are celebrated for their quiet operation and gentle, lasting warmth. Users often commend their ability to maintain a consistent temperature without frequent operation, benefiting both comfort and cost savings over time. Despite these advantages, some users are less impressed with their slower heat-up time compared to other models. Another point of feedback is their weight and bulkiness, which, while adding to their stability, can make them less portable.

Best Practices for Safe Operation

To enhance space heater safety, position the heater on a stable surface, keeping it away from flammable materials. Ensure an unobstructed airflow, which not only maintains proper function but also prevents overheating. For further safety, opt for models equipped with safety features like tip-over and overheat protection, which automatically turn off the device in unsafe conditions.

Prolonging Space Heater Longevity

Routine maintenance extends the heater’s lifespan. Regularly check and clean filters, as dust accumulation can hamper efficiency and safety. Ensure cords and plugs remain intact, and replace them if signs of wear appear. Proper storage when not in use also helps maintain the unit’s condition.

Maximising Heating Efficiency

To achieve energy savings, use heaters with adjustable thermostats to maintain consistent warmth without excessive energy use. Shut doors and windows in the heated space to preserve warmth, and consider pairing the heater with insulation improvements to reduce energy consumption further.
